Just my 10p but I have to agree that there are 2 sides to every story. Look at it like this, i have been over taken by some right clowns in some dangerous places and it has really boiled my blood that some plum feels its ok to put my and others lives in danger, and i am sure you have all been there. I dont know what happened or how fast or dangerous the overtake was but it clearly boiled the blood of this "copper" so he decided to act on it. By the way, officers have a duty of care to act if they see a crime being committed even if they are in their swimwear as long as they dont put themselves in danger doing so. If the guy was driving like a dangerous **** and killed someone down the road i eonder what the reaction of the public would be when they found a copper saw him but did nothing......

Proof is not needed, a Section 59 can even be issued, if 3 members of the public report someone in a 7 day period for any different motoring offences, from Dangerous Driving, Loud Music, Wheel spinning etc... The law is set to scre" the motorist.
and the chap is right their is no such thing as Off duty. all he has to do is phone in and they will book him as on Duty, giving him his full powers, yes section 59 has to be given by a uniformed officer, but a non uniformed officer can ask a Uniformed officer to give the section 59, Proof is NOT required, the law on section 59 gives the motorist no protection... IMO the law should have no legal backing, but it does... and unfortunately it's down to you to prove you were not doing as they claim under this act.

I have plenty of experience with coppers.
Only a traffic car can get you done for a speeding, traffic light, dangerous driving etc as they need video evidence if taken to court, but most people own upto doing wrong and then your given a ticket/fine/points.
A local plod car can try and do you for speeding but if you admit to it then you've got yourself a ticket, but if you take it to court then the cps will throw it out as there is no video evidence or will get thrown out of court due to no video evidence unless there is multiple witness (general public).
Most people get that scared of being pulled and own upto it without thinking logically, which puts you in a position were you can't back out then as by then you've signed the ticket.
To the op, I wouldn't worry and if you do get a ticket, contest the ticket to go before the court and ask for video proof.
